What is Masters Swimming?

Masters swimming is an organized program for adults typically aged 18 and older. It provides structured workouts, coaching, and opportunities for competition, but participation is entirely voluntary. Programs emphasize fitness, friendship, and fun.

Popular Masters Swim Clubs in Seattle

Seattle boasts a vibrant masters swimming community with several well-regarded clubs:

  • Seattle Metropolitan Masters (SMM): One of the largest and most established clubs in the region, offering a wide range of practice times and locations.
  • Puget Sound Masters (PSM): A competitive-focused club known for its strong performance in swim meets.
  • Various YMCA and community pool programs: Many local pools offer masters swimming programs with a focus on fitness and recreation.

It’s recommended to contact the clubs directly to inquire about membership fees, practice schedules, and skill level requirements.

FAQs about Masters Swimming in Seattle

Is masters swimming only for former competitive swimmers?

No, masters swimming is open to adults of all skill levels. Many members are beginners or recreational swimmers looking to improve their fitness.

What equipment do I need to start masters swimming?

Basic equipment includes a swimsuit, goggles, and a swim cap. Some teams may recommend additional equipment such as fins, pull buoys, and kickboards.

How often should I attend practices?

The frequency of practices depends on your goals and schedule. Most teams offer multiple practices per week, and you can choose to attend as many as you like.

Do I have to compete in swim meets?

No, competition is optional. Many masters swimmers participate for fitness and social reasons only.
